ATS-Optimized for US Market

Lead Scala Architect: Delivering Scalable, High-Performance Systems for Critical Applications

In the US job market, recruiters spend seconds scanning a resume. They look for impact (metrics), clear tech or domain skills, and education. This guide helps you build an ATS-friendly Executive Scala Programmer resume that passes filters used by top US companies. Use US Letter size, one page for under 10 years experience, and no photo.

Expert Tip: For Executive Scala Programmer positions in the US, recruiters increasingly look for technical execution and adaptability over simple job duties. This guide is tailored to highlight these specific traits to ensure your resume stands out in the competitive Executive Scala Programmer sector.

What US Hiring Managers Look For in a Executive Scala Programmer Resume

When reviewing Executive Scala Programmer candidates, recruiters and hiring managers in the US focus on a few critical areas. Making these elements clear and easy to find on your resume will improve your chances of moving to the interview stage.

  • Relevant experience and impact in Executive Scala Programmer or closely related roles.
  • Clear, measurable achievements (metrics, scope, outcomes) rather than duties.
  • Skills and keywords that match the job description and ATS requirements.
  • Professional formatting and no spelling or grammar errors.
  • Consistency between your resume, LinkedIn, and application.

Essential Skills for Executive Scala Programmer

Include these keywords in your resume to pass ATS screening and impress recruiters.

  • Relevant experience and impact in Executive Scala Programmer or closely related roles.
  • Clear, measurable achievements (metrics, scope, outcomes) rather than duties.
  • Skills and keywords that match the job description and ATS requirements.
  • Professional formatting and no spelling or grammar errors.
  • Consistency between your resume, LinkedIn, and application.

A Day in the Life

As an Executive Scala Programmer, my day starts with a team stand-up to discuss project progress and address any roadblocks in our distributed systems. I then dive into code, often focusing on optimizing existing Scala applications for performance and scalability using tools like Akka and Spark. A significant portion of my day involves architectural design sessions, collaborating with other engineers to define the next generation of our platform. I attend meetings with product managers to align technical solutions with business requirements and present technical roadmaps to stakeholders. I also perform code reviews, mentor junior developers, and conduct research on emerging technologies to improve our development practices. A key deliverable is well-documented, testable, and maintainable Scala code that meets the highest standards of quality and security.

Career Progression Path

Level 1

Entry-level or junior Executive Scala Programmer roles (building foundational skills).

Level 2

Mid-level Executive Scala Programmer (independent ownership and cross-team work).

Level 3

Senior or lead Executive Scala Programmer (mentorship and larger scope).

Level 4

Principal, manager, or director (strategy and team/org impact).

Interview Questions & Answers

Prepare for your Executive Scala Programmer interview with these commonly asked questions.

Describe a time you had to lead a team to overcome a significant technical challenge in a Scala project. What was your approach, and what was the outcome?

Medium
Behavioral
Sample Answer
In my previous role, we were tasked with migrating a critical legacy system to a Scala-based microservices architecture. The challenge was the tight deadline and the complexity of the existing system. I broke down the project into smaller, manageable tasks, assigned them to team members based on their strengths, and established clear communication channels. I facilitated daily stand-ups, conducted code reviews, and provided technical guidance. The migration was completed on time and within budget, resulting in a 30% improvement in system performance and scalability. This involved effective team collaboration and proactive problem-solving.

Explain your experience with Akka and how you've used it to build scalable and resilient systems.

Technical
Technical
Sample Answer
I have extensive experience using Akka to build high-performance, concurrent, and distributed systems. In one project, I used Akka actors to implement a real-time data processing pipeline that handled millions of events per day. I utilized Akka's clustering capabilities to distribute the workload across multiple nodes, ensuring high availability and fault tolerance. I also implemented supervision strategies to handle actor failures gracefully, preventing cascading failures and maintaining system stability. I am familiar with Akka Streams, Akka HTTP, and Akka Persistence and have used them in various projects to solve complex problems.

Imagine you are tasked with improving the performance of a slow-running Scala application. How would you approach this problem?

Medium
Situational
Sample Answer
My first step would be to profile the application to identify the performance bottlenecks. I'd use tools like VisualVM or JProfiler to pinpoint the areas where the application is spending the most time. Once I've identified the bottlenecks, I would analyze the code to identify areas for optimization, such as inefficient algorithms, excessive memory allocation, or unnecessary I/O operations. I would then implement optimizations, such as using more efficient data structures, caching frequently accessed data, or parallelizing computations using Scala's concurrency features. I would then re-profile the application to verify that the optimizations have improved performance. Finally, I would thoroughly test the application to ensure that the changes haven't introduced any regressions.

How do you stay up-to-date with the latest trends and technologies in the Scala ecosystem?

Easy
Behavioral
Sample Answer
I actively participate in the Scala community by attending conferences, reading blogs, and contributing to open-source projects. I follow prominent Scala developers and thought leaders on social media and subscribe to relevant newsletters. I regularly experiment with new libraries and frameworks to stay abreast of the latest developments. I also dedicate time to learning new functional programming concepts and techniques. I believe that continuous learning is essential for staying relevant and effective as a Scala programmer.

Describe a complex data processing pipeline you've built using Scala and Spark. What were the key challenges, and how did you overcome them?

Hard
Technical
Sample Answer
I once led the development of a large-scale data processing pipeline that used Scala and Spark to analyze customer behavior data. The key challenges were handling the massive volume of data, ensuring data quality, and optimizing the pipeline for performance. I used Spark's distributed processing capabilities to process the data in parallel. I implemented data validation checks to ensure data quality and prevent errors from propagating through the pipeline. I also used Spark's caching and partitioning features to optimize the pipeline for performance. By optimizing Spark configurations and using appropriate data structures, we were able to significantly reduce the processing time and improve the overall efficiency of the pipeline.

You are tasked with mentoring a junior developer on a complex Scala project. How would you approach this?

Medium
Situational
Sample Answer
I would start by understanding the junior developer's current skillset and experience level. I would then assign them tasks that are challenging but achievable, providing guidance and support as needed. I would encourage them to ask questions and provide constructive feedback on their code. I would also pair them with more experienced developers to facilitate knowledge sharing and collaboration. I would emphasize the importance of writing clean, testable, and well-documented code. I would also encourage them to participate in code reviews and learn from the feedback they receive. I believe that mentoring is an essential part of building a strong and effective development team.

ATS Optimization Tips

Make sure your resume passes Applicant Tracking Systems used by US employers.

Use exact keywords from the job description, particularly in the skills and experience sections. ATS systems scan for these terms to match candidates with open positions.
Format your resume with clear section headings like "Summary," "Skills," "Experience," and "Education." This helps ATS systems parse the information correctly.
List your skills using bullet points and separate them into categories such as "Programming Languages," "Frameworks," "Tools," and "Cloud Technologies."
Quantify your achievements whenever possible, using metrics to demonstrate the impact of your work. For example, "Improved application performance by 20%."
Use a simple and clean font like Arial, Calibri, or Times New Roman. Avoid using decorative fonts that ATS systems may not be able to read.
Save your resume as a PDF file. This preserves the formatting and ensures that ATS systems can read the content accurately.
Include a skills matrix that highlights your key technical skills and proficiency levels. This provides a quick overview for recruiters and ATS systems.
Check your resume for common errors such as typos, grammatical mistakes, and formatting inconsistencies. These errors can negatively impact your chances of getting an interview.

Common Resume Mistakes to Avoid

Don't make these errors that get resumes rejected.

1
Listing only job duties without quantifiable achievements or impact.
2
Using a generic resume for every Executive Scala Programmer application instead of tailoring to the job.
3
Including irrelevant or outdated experience that dilutes your message.
4
Using complex layouts, graphics, or columns that break ATS parsing.
5
Leaving gaps unexplained or using vague dates.
6
Writing a long summary or objective instead of a concise, achievement-focused one.

Industry Outlook

The US job market for Executive Scala Programmers is strong, driven by the increasing need for scalable and reliable backend systems in industries like finance, e-commerce, and data analytics. Demand is high for experienced professionals who can lead development teams and architect complex solutions. Remote opportunities are plentiful, enabling candidates to work for companies across the country. Top candidates differentiate themselves with deep expertise in functional programming, distributed systems, and cloud technologies, along with strong leadership and communication skills. Certifications in relevant technologies and contributions to open-source projects are also highly valued.

Top Hiring Companies

Capital OneNetflixTwitterMorgan StanleyComcastDisneyCourseraWalmart

Frequently Asked Questions

How long should my Executive Scala Programmer resume be?

For an executive-level role like Executive Scala Programmer, a two-page resume is generally acceptable, especially if you have extensive experience and accomplishments. Focus on showcasing your most relevant skills and achievements using Scala, Akka, Spark, and other related technologies. Prioritize quantifiable results and tailor your resume to each specific job application. Avoid including irrelevant information or unnecessary details to keep your resume concise and impactful.

What are the most important skills to highlight on my resume?

For an Executive Scala Programmer role, emphasize your expertise in Scala, functional programming principles, and distributed systems. Highlight experience with frameworks like Akka, Spark, and Kafka. Showcase your ability to design and implement scalable and reliable systems. Include your experience with cloud platforms (AWS, Azure, GCP) and DevOps practices. Strong leadership, communication, and problem-solving skills are also crucial, demonstrating your ability to manage teams and deliver complex projects successfully.

How can I ensure my resume is ATS-friendly?

To optimize your resume for Applicant Tracking Systems (ATS), use a clean and simple format with standard section headings like "Summary," "Experience," "Skills," and "Education." Avoid using tables, images, or unusual fonts that ATS systems may not be able to parse correctly. Incorporate relevant keywords from the job description throughout your resume, particularly in the skills and experience sections. Save your resume as a PDF to preserve formatting while ensuring it's readable by ATS software. Tools like Jobscan can help analyze your resume for ATS compatibility.

Are certifications important for an Executive Scala Programmer resume?

While not always mandatory, certifications can enhance your resume and demonstrate your commitment to professional development. Consider certifications related to cloud platforms (AWS Certified Developer, Azure Solutions Architect Expert), Scala programming (e.g., a Lightbend certification), or project management (PMP). Highlight any relevant certifications prominently on your resume to showcase your expertise and credibility. Certifications signal that you have validated knowledge and skills in these areas.

What are common mistakes to avoid on an Executive Scala Programmer resume?

Common mistakes include using generic language, failing to quantify achievements, and neglecting to tailor your resume to each job application. Avoid simply listing your responsibilities; instead, focus on showcasing your accomplishments and the impact you made in previous roles. Ensure your resume is free of typos and grammatical errors. Don't exaggerate your skills or experience. Always proofread your resume carefully before submitting it. Also, avoid using outdated technologies or frameworks that are no longer relevant to the current job market.

How should I address a career transition on my Executive Scala Programmer resume?

If you're transitioning from a different role to an Executive Scala Programmer position, focus on highlighting transferable skills and experiences. Emphasize any projects or experiences where you used Scala or related technologies, even if they weren't your primary responsibilities. Consider including a brief summary statement explaining your career transition and your passion for Scala development. Tailor your resume to highlight the skills and experiences that are most relevant to the target role. Consider taking online courses or certifications to demonstrate your commitment to learning Scala and related technologies.

Ready to Build Your Executive Scala Programmer Resume?

Use our AI-powered resume builder to create an ATS-optimized resume tailored for Executive Scala Programmer positions in the US market.

Complete Executive Scala Programmer Career Toolkit

Everything you need for your Executive Scala Programmer job search — all in one platform.

Why choose ResumeGyani over Zety or Resume.io?

The only platform with AI mock interviews + resume builder + job search + career coaching — all in one.

See comparison

Last updated: March 2026 · Content reviewed by certified resume writers · Optimized for US job market

Executive Scala Programmer Resume Examples & Templates for 2027 (ATS-Passed)